[edit] Raphanus sativus var. niger
- Also known as (or relevant to)
- Family
- Cruciferae
- English Names
- Natural Habitat
- Part(s) Used
|
- Constituent(s)
- raphanol
- volatile oil
- vitamin C
- Action
- hepatic
- diuretic
- aperient
- used in gall disorders; juice: used in whooping cough

[edit] Raphanus sativus var. radicula
- Also known as (or relevant to)
- Family
- Cruciferae
- English Names
- Natural Habitat
- cultivated in Europe (including Great Britain)
- temperate Asia
- China
- Japan
- Cochin-China
- Part(s) Used
- Radix Raphani sativi var. radiculae
|
- Constituent(s)
- raphanol
- albuminoids
- carbohydrates
- phosphorus
- sulphur
- vitamin C
- senevol
- Action
- tonic
- appetising
- depurative
- diuretic
- hepatic
- antiscorbutic
- expectorant
- stimulant
- used for culinary purposes
